FAQs About QuickBooks Enterprise vs Lexos

In conclusion, QuickBooks Enterprise and Lexos each offer unique advantages tailored to different business needs. QuickBooks Enterprise excels in its robust accounting features, scalability, and extensive integration options, making it ideal for larger organizations. Conversely, Lexos provides a more user-friendly interface and streamlined processes, appealing to small to mid-sized businesses seeking simplicity. Ultimately, the choice between the two depends on the specific requirements, budget, and growth plans of the business, ensuring that users select the best fit for their financial management needs.
